Is the Emacs mode being actively also developed?  If so, is there a
project/repository somewhere?

That depends. We've had our emacs mode sitting in the elisp/ directory for quite a while. I started a minimal thing hoping it would be fixed,
and never put time into it.

Nicolas wrote a more advanced thing, lyqi and recently David Kastrup
mentioned he wanted to work on it.

I think it would be nice if the efforts could be joined and have
lyqi merged with lilypond's [new?] mode, or with emacs.

I use lilypond-mode as my only tool for writing .ly files and even as is it works very well indeed. I have not tried lyqi.
